How to fix the XDefiant MIKE-01 error code

If you’re trying to play XDefiant, but are met with the MIKE-01 error code, we’ve got they why and how you can get around it.

XDefiant is a free-to-play first-person shooter, and of course, you must be online at all times to play it. There are moments where that issue may not be your fault, especially if you receive the XDefiant MIKE-01 error code.

There's a slight chance it is on your end, but more often than not, MIKE-01 is a problem with Ubisoft directly. And it is a common code among its games, with The Division and The Division 2 employing the code first.

Why are you getting the XDefiant MIKE-01 error code?

Here is a list of reasons as to why you might receive the MIKE-01 error code when trying to load into XDefiant:

  • The game is not available in your region
  • You are not properly connected to the internet
  • You do not have the latest XDefiant update or patch installed
  • The XDefiant servers are down due to a Ubisoft issue or possible maintanence

That's really all there is to it. MIKE-01 appears in XDefiant whenever you can't connect to the servers, for whatever reason that may be.

How to fix the MIKE-01 error in XDefiant

If you're frustrated with the MIKE-01 error code in XDefiant, we've got a few tips on how to resolve it. These aren't foolproof methods, as there truly isn't one, but they should at least help you understand what is causing the problem.

Try these fixes out and see how they do:

  • Ensure you are connected to the internet
  • Restart your PC or console
  • Update XDefiant to the latest patch
  • Verify the integrity of the game file
  • Completely uninstall and reinstall the game incase the files became corrupt in any way
  • Double check to see if the game has a server or is even allowed in your region
    • Use a VPN to bypass it if you have to
  • Look to official XDefiant or Ubisoft websites and social media accounts for any indication of server issues or ongoing server maintenance that has taken the game down

If you ask any XDefiant player, 9/10 times MIKE-01 appears simply because the servers are down. You can try all of the other fixes, but nothing will truly resolve the matter if Ubisoft has taken them offline. At that point, patience is the name of the game.
